Crimes committed by Kyrgyz migrants in Russia have increased in number

This was announced at the Embassy of the Kyrgyz Republic in Moscow.

The number of crimes committed by migrants from the Kyrgyz Republic on the territory of the Russian Federation have increased in number. This statement was made by employees of the Embassy of the Kyrgyz Republic in Moscow, the press office of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Kyrgyz Republic reported.

A meeting on this problem was organised at the Embassy at the initiative of the Kyrgyz diaspora in the capital of the Russian Federation. Employees of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Kyrgyz Republic and migrant workers attended the meeting.

The officials provided brief information about the work done in the first six months of the year, paying particular attention to the difficulties in achieving legalized status for Kyrgyz citizens in the Russian Federation.

The participants agreed to meet more often, as such meetings contribute to reducing the number of crimes committed by migrants from the Central Asian state.
